### **The This means of Bitachon**

In its most basic sense, Bitachon is believe in in God. Even so, its comprehensive which means goes significantly outside of mere perception in God's power or existence. Bitachon is about a deep-seated self-assurance that God is answerable for all the things that happens on the planet and in one’s personal lifestyle. It requires surrendering one particular’s possess feeling of Management and putting full reliance on God’s will. This have faith in makes it possible for someone to Dwell with peace, safety, and a sense of purpose, knowing that, regardless of what difficulties arise, God’s approach is often for the top.

Even though the phrase Bitachon is often made use of interchangeably with Emunah (faith), There's a refined distinction between the two. Emunah refers to perception in God’s existence and His attributes, whilst Bitachon signifies a more specific and Lively type of trust. It is far from basically an intellectual acknowledgment that God exists but an psychological and sensible reliance on God to immediate 1’s everyday living in the best way.

### **The Relationship Amongst Bitachon and Motion**

A common misunderstanding about Bitachon is the fact that it indicates passivity or inaction, Using the perception that God will take care of anything with no exertion from the person. On the other hand, Jewish teachings emphasize that even though Bitachon demands trust in God, it does not absolve someone from taking obligation or making initiatives.

In actual fact, Jewish tradition advocates for just a balanced technique: although a person trusts in God’s aid, just one have to also make useful initiatives. The Talmud teaches that “a person that's going for walks and stumbles shouldn't say, ‘I'll look ahead to a wonder,’ but fairly, ‘I'll lift myself up.’” Which means that while somebody will have to rely on in God, they have to also get the mandatory techniques to attain their objectives. Bitachon doesn’t suggest inaction but instead that, right after just one has done their best, they can be assured that the ultimate final result is in God’s fingers.
